After 2000 miles and a lot of brilliant experience I'm in the process of buying my first boat. I'm looking for something cheap, but very seaworthy and capable of long distance cruising.
Everything points to a folkboat, and I'm very impressed by what folkboat owners and former folkboat owners say about them. The lack of cabin space doesn't worry me too much, but I am worried about the maintaince required of a wooden boat. In fact, I'd discounted wooden boats because of the maintainance required.
Does anybody have any experience with maintaining wooden folkboats? What's involved? Am I wrong in hesitating to look at a wooden boat?
